What the White Card In Fact Covers
The White Card is linked to a national device of proficiency, entitled Prepare to function safely in the building industry. You will certainly see it listed by Registered Training Organisations as CPCCWHS1001 or CPCWHS1001, depending on which version of the training plan they have on extent. Either is valid if the carrier is approved.
The training course educates foundational security skills, not trade understanding. You will certainly cover threat recognition, risk control basics, personal safety devices, QLD white card training online signs and barricading, emergency situation procedures, and how to report incidents or risky conditions. A great trainer will equate the concept into functional judgment. For example, you may be revealed a collection of photos from real Brisbane builds, then asked to identify the problems and make a decision which regulate steps would decrease the possibility of harm. Expect to manage PPE, practice communication, and full both written and spoken assessments.
The card is identified across Australia. If you acquire your white card training in Brisbane QLD, you can utilize it on tasks in other states, supplied you meet the issuing needs and keep evidence of your training.
Who Demands It in Brisbane
Anyone that carries out building and construction work with a website in Queensland requires a white card. That consists of labourers, apprentices, site engineers, task managers, estimators visiting active works, electricians, plumbers, concreters, scaffolders, landscaping companies took part in building phases, and many maintenance employees throughout shutdowns or refurbishments. Even brief site visits count if you will enter a workspace where building activities take place. Site visitors accompanied for a brief conference in a site office may be excluded, however the minute you cross into a controlled building and construction zone, the policy applies.
Most principal specialists in Brisbane treat it as non negotiable. If you turn up without a White Card or legitimate proof of training, they will send you home. The lost time expenses much more than the program fee, and you run the risk of the connection with the website's safety team. Face to Face, Virtual, or Online in Queensland
You will find a lot of search results page for white card online Brisbane, usually with nationwide service providers. Queensland's regulator establishes shipment policies to make sure the training is interactive, the identity of the learner is validated, and the analysis is genuine. In method, this means most white card training courses Brisbane broad are delivered in a class. Some Brisbane white card training providers additionally run live virtual courses with live video, where the instructor can see you complete the functional jobs and inspect your ID. Self paced, click through on-line components without a live instructor normally do not satisfy Queensland requirements for providing a White Card to a QLD address.
If rate issues, search for a Brisbane white card course with numerous everyday begin times and on the day issuance of a Statement of Achievement. Late mid-day or evening sessions can be helpful if you are attempting to fast lane before a website induction the adhering to morning.

How the Day Commonly Runs
A class based white card program Brisbane providers run will usually take 6 to 8 hours, consisting of breaks. You will sign in, have your ID confirmed, and the instructor will certainly explain exactly how the assessment functions. Anticipate a mix of brief talks, discussions, case studies, and sensible demos. Fitness instructors in Brisbane commonly add local context, like the method summertime warm influences hands-on handling plans, or the lightning protocols utilized over increase puts throughout mid-day storms.
Assessment is usually split into elements. There will be understanding checks across the day, rather than a solitary high stress test at the end. You may function play reporting a risk to a supervisor, complete a standard threat assessment using the hierarchy of controls, and demonstrate right use of PPE. If anything is vague, state so early. Fitness instructors prefer concerns while the team is on the topic, and a few mins of mentoring can lift a borderline response to a competent one.
Assuming you fulfill the standard, you will receive a Statement of Achievement. For numerous companies, that suffices to begin job while the physical Brisbane white card shows up. Maintain a photo or PDF copy on your phone as backup.

Can You Use a Card From An Additional State in Queensland
A white card is across the country identified. If you were provided a legitimate card in one more state, you can use it on jobs in Brisbane, presuming it is genuine and you can generate evidence if questioned. That claimed, particular big service providers like to sight the Statement of Attainment, specifically when the card looks used or was released many years ago. If your card is exceptionally old or you have been out of building for a long stretch, it may be quicker to finish a present Brisbane white card training course than to suggest the point at a gatehouse at 5:45 am.

What Happens After You Obtain the Card
The White Card opens up the gate, yet every site still needs a task induction. Expect to cover regional threats, website traffic strategies, lift protocols, hot jobs, plant interaction, allows, and emergency calls. You may additionally require additional tickets relying on your function. Operating at elevations, confined space access, dogging, and EWP prevail follow ons. A white card training course Brisbane is not a substitute for those job certain competencies.


On your very first day, be predictable and conventional. Use your PPE appropriately. Observe exemption areas and barricades. Never improvise with tools or plant you have actually not been authorised to utilize. The fastest method to develop trust fund with a Brisbane site security team is to show that you know when to quit and ask.

Edge Cases, Pitfalls, and How to Stay clear of Them
The most typical factor individuals stop working to complete on the day is incomplete ID. RTOs need to validate that you are. If you just bring a Medicare card with a nickname that does not match your USI document, the instructor's hands are tied. Usage complete lawful names constantly. Suit your USI details to your ID. If your permit is run out, restore it or bring a legitimate passport.
Another mistake is undervaluing the language, literacy, and numeracy part. The training course is not scholastic, yet you need to check out signage, full brief written reactions, and recognize threat concepts. If you are rustic, ask the supplier concerning support. Several offer affordable adjustments like oral questioning for components of the analysis, provided honesty is maintained. If you have learning differences, reveal them early. Trainers want you to prosper, and they can prepare seats, pacing, or alternative styles if they know in advance.
Finally, punctuality matters. Carriers often have a tough start time linked to evaluation methods. If you miss the structure rundown, they might not be enabled to admit you. Factor in Brisbane traffic, or utilize a train to the CBD if the course is near Central or Roma Street. It is better to arrive 20 minutes early and have a coffee close by than to lose a day.
Practical Safety and security Lessons That Stick in Brisbane
A white card is about attitude as long as compliance. Regional conditions shape the threats. Brisbane's summer warmth and moisture can turn a regular task into a dehydration risk by mid early morning. Develop a water habit early and view your friends for indicators of heat tension. Afternoon tornados roll with fast. I have based on a structure where a team determined to sneak in another lift as the sky went green. They spent the next 40 mins safeguarding, seeing gusts rotate debris throughout the deck. The website supervisor's comment later was brief and reasonable. The most effective lift is the one you hold off prior to the wind arrives.
Working around mobile plant is another Brisbane constant. Limited central city websites require closeness in between pedestrians and machinery. Never assume a driver has seen you, despite mirrors and electronic cameras. Make eye get in touch with, get a recognition, and utilize the assigned sidewalks. If you find yourself believing, I will just cross, quit and take the lengthy way.
Noise levels over rise or bridgework tasks can be brutal. Hearing security is not optional. The short-lived comfort of leaving your muffs in a pocket does not outweigh the long-term expense of ringing in the ears. An instructor as soon as placed it clearly during white card Brisbane training. You can neglect your ears today, however you can not overlook the buzzing later.
Renewal and Currency
White cards do not come with an expiration date printed on them, however money issues. In Queensland, if you have actually not carried out building work for an extensive duration, you might be called for to redesign the training to rejuvenate your understanding. A typical threshold made use of by industry is two years out of the market. If you are returning after a lengthy break, think about reserving a brand-new Brisbane white card course. The regulations, equipment, and expectations advance. A half day back in a class costs less than a solitary day lost to a preventable incident.
Employers usually run refresher course toolbox talks or short safety and security components on warm stress, silica exposure, or plant watchman tasks. Deal with those as component of remaining current. Your white card is the structure. Ongoing learning maintains it honest.
